Why Trump’s hair has turned pink

A hairstylist has revealed the reason why Donald Trump’s hair appeared pink during a speech delivered in Washington D.C. on Tuesday. 

As Trump, 79, addressed members of the Republican Party at the John F. Kennedy Center for the Performing Arts yesterday, his hair was unmistakably pink-tinged, with social media users likening it to ‘cotton candy’. 

According to London-based hairstylist Gustav Fouche, the pinkish shade ‘could be related to toning.’ 

Fouche told the Daily Mail: ‘To achieve a silver or lighter blonde look, violet tones are often added to neutralise yellow. 

‘However, if too much violet is used or it’s left on slightly too long, it can shift the colour and make the hair appear pinkish rather than cool or neutral.’

The President’s daughter, Ivanka Trump, who served as a White House adviser during his first term of office, has previously said that her father dyed his hair using a product called Just for Men, which generally works to hide grey hairs.

However, Fouche emphasised that there are a number of other factors that could have made the president’s hair appear slightly pink.

The hairstylist said: ‘One common reason is lighting. Overhead or stage lighting (especially warmer-toned lights) can cast a pinkish or warm reflection onto light or silver hair. 

Donald Trump (pictured) gave a speech to the Republican Party at the Kennedy Center on Tuesday - but people online were more concerned with his supposedly pink hair than what he had to say

‘We see this often with clients who have grey or silver hair; their colour can look completely different depending on the lighting they’re under.

‘Another factor could be colour reflection from the surroundings. For example, if there’s a red backdrop or flag behind him and strong lighting hitting that area, the reflected light can bounce back onto the hair and create a subtle pink or warm tint.’
